## Summary
The Swedish Institute of Computer Science (SICS) is a research institute located in Kista, Sweden, dedicated to primary research in the field of computer science. Established in 1985, the organization serves as a central hub for scientific advancement and is affiliated with prominent researchers in the Nordic region.

### Institutional Profile
The Swedish Institute of Computer Science, widely known as SICS, is a research institute based in Sweden. It is classified as an organization whose primary purpose is research. The institute was founded in 1985 and has since established itself as a key component of the Swedish scientific community.

### Location and Geography
SICS is located in Kista, a district of Stockholm known for its high concentration of technology companies and research facilities. The institute's physical location is recorded at the coordinates 59.4049 latitude and 17.9496 longitude.

### Key Personnel and Affiliations
The institute is associated with several notable academics and computer scientists:
*   **Kristina Höök:** A Swedish computer scientist, researcher, and professor born in 1964.
*   **Bogumil Hausman:** A Polish computer scientist born in 1956 who is affiliated with the organization.
